Reports

In connection with the profile attributes, the competitor database also allows you to analyze the information through the CRM Report Center. By default, the following reports are available there:

  • Sales development
  • ROS development
  • Strengths / weaknesses profile
  • Profit development
  • Won / lost projects
  • Top N competitors
Strengths / Weaknesses profile

Graphic presentation of the "critical success factors" parameters for one or more competitors. The data is presented in the form of a polarity profile.

Note: If you intend to make comparisons with your own parameters, simply create a "compet­itor" profile for your company and maintain the parameters in the profile data.

Sales, profit and ROS development

Comparative representation of the profit, sales and ROS development over the course of 10 years for one or more competitors. If no region or business segment is selected, the parameters are determined by accumulating all regions or, respectively, business segments.

Competitor data sheet

You can create a multiple-page data sheet at the compet­itor form, which contains all profile data of the competitor as a chart, and is provided as a PDF file.

Note: The data sheet intentionally omits the sales cases in the Competitive situation tab. For presenting the competitive situations, dynamic reports are provided.

Dynamic reports, graphic analyses

Graphic analyses of the competitor profile are constantly updated automatically in the Report­ings subform. This is ensured by the automatic Competitor-analyses job (run at night) that creates the following reports for every competitor:

  • Data sheet
  • Profit development
  • Won / lost projects
  • ROS development
  • Strengths / weaknesses profile
  • Sales trend

These dynamic reports can be found in the Reportings subform in the competitor management. Select a report and press Preview to display the report as a PDF preview.
